Output 53caca03b982d1ce90f1ef83fa141a6231274c03e2bcd3c69ae02ff06759f717:9

value
22939000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4738bec8761623192e5df45b17313fcf3a874ab1 OP_EQUAL
address
38BbstinH6TqJdyWnCJC8g2gD4dcr4TfSk
transaction
53caca03b982d1ce90f1ef83fa141a6231274c03e2bcd3c69ae02ff06759f717
spent
true